This three bedroomed semi-detached house is in a quality development of three and four bedroomed semi-detached homes, built just over 6 years ago by Inchagoill Contractors.
The area has an improving infrastructure with the development close by of the Knocknacarra Shopping Centre with anchor tenants Dunnes Stores and B&Q Homewares due to open their doors soon. Schools and leisure facilities are all within a short distance of the estate as is Salthill Promenade. Bus transport is available with regular services in to the city centre passing by NUIG and UHCG.

The property comes with a converted attic space and a beautifully laid patio area to the rear with a block-built, tiled-roof shed.

Internally, there is complete tiling in the main bathroom and en suite and floor tiling in the kitchen and dining areas. All of the bedrooms have timber floors and in two of the largest ones, there are double built-in-wardrobes.

The house has a gas fireplace and the main souce of heating is oil fired central heating.
